49ers and guard Mike Person agree to a 3-year, $9 million deal

The San Francisco 49ers and Mike Person have agreed to a new three-year deal that will pay the guard up to $9 million with $3 million guaranteed, according to Adam Schefter of ESPN. He was scheduled to become a free agent on March 13. 49ers and starting right guard Mike Person...
